To determine the correct answer, you need to understand the definitions of the given options:

1. Analogy: An analogy is a comparison between two things that have similar features, often used to explain something unfamiliar by comparing it to something familiar.
2. Antonym: An antonym is a word that has the opposite meaning of another word.
3. Degree: Degree refers to the level or extent of something.
4. Synonym: A synonym is a word or phrase that has the same or nearly the same meaning as another word or phrase.
